SOA Web Service合约设计与版本化

SOA Web Service合约设计与版本化

(美) 俄尔 (Erl,T.) , 等著

出版社:人民邮电出版社

年代:2009

定价:79.0

书籍简介:

本书首先简要回顾了SOA与面向服务的基本概念和关键目标,然后着重阐述了与Web服务合约的设计和演化相关的各种话题。主要内容包括WSDL、SOAP、XML Schema、WS-Policy以及消息设计的相关技术(SOAP和WS-Addressing)。

书籍目录:

第1章概述

第2章案例研究背景

第1部分基本服务合约设计

第3章SOA基础和Web服务合约

第4章Web服务合约剖析

第5章关于命名空间的简明指南

第6章基本XMLSchema:类型和消息结构基础

第7章基本WSDL(一):抽象描述设计

第8章基本WSDL(二):具体描述设计

第9章基本WSDL2.0:新特性与设计选项

第10章基本WS-Policy:断言、表达式与附加项

第11章基本消息设计:SOAP信封结构、故障消息与报头处理

第2部分高级服务合约设计

第12章高级XMLSchema(一):消息灵活性、类型继承与组合

第13章高级XMLSchema(二):可复用性、关系设计与业界模式

第14章高级WSDL(一):模块化、可扩展性、MEP与异步

第15章高级WSDL(二):消息分发、服务实例标识与非SOAP的HTTP绑定

第16章高级WS-Policy(一):策略集中化与嵌套、参数化和可忽略的断言

第17章高级WS-Policy(二):定制策略断言设计、运行时表示与兼容性

第18章高级消息设计(一):WS-Addressing词汇表

第19章高级消息设计(二):WS-Addressing规则与设计技巧

第3部分服务合约版本化

第20章版本化基础

第21章WSDL定义的版本化

第22章消息模式的版本化

第23章高级版本化

第4部分附录

附录A案例研究总结

附录B技术标准的制定过程

附录CC伪模式列表525

附录D本书用到的命名空间与前缀

附录E与本书有关的SOAP设计模式

内容摘要:

  WebService要想成功地成为SOA的一部分,它们就需要平衡而有效的技术合约来支持服务的演化,并且在未来许多年可以被多次复用。现在,由全球最畅销的SOA作者与业界顶尖专家组成的团队为我们呈现了关于支持SOA的WebService合约设计与治理的第一本全面指南。  本书首先简要回顾了SOA与面向服务的基本概念和关键目标,然后着重阐述了与Web服务合约的设计和演化相关的各种话题。通过阅读本书,读者不仅可以学到在SOA中Web服务合约设计与版本化的基本技术,并且可以深入理解如何构建Web服务合约来支持面向服务。  本书首先简要回顾了SOA与面向服务的基本概念和关键目标,然后着重阐述了与Web服务合约的设计和演化相关的各种话题。主要内容包括WSDL、SOAP、XMLSchema、WS-Policy以及消息设计的相关技术(SOAP和WS-Addressing)。本书着重在SOA的上下文中论述Web服务合约技术,并且介绍了可以用于合约设计和版本化的各种设计模式。本书同时还提供了许多代码示例,可以帮助读者从实际案例中掌握如何在实践中运用相关的技术和原则。通过阅读本书,读者不仅可以学到在SOA中Web服务合约设计与版本化的基本技术,并且可以深入理解如何构建Web服务合约来支持面向服务。  本书作者包括了来自SOA、Web服务技术、服务合约设计以及服务版本化和治理等领域的顶级专家学者。其中主要作者ThomasErl是业界公认的SOA领袖,本书以及他的其他著作被许多著名跨国公司的资深专家誉为“必备的SOA参考书”。  本书的读者对象是对面向服务架构、Web服务技术和服务合约版本化感兴趣的IT开发人员、分析师与架构师。【作者简介】  俄尔(ThomasErl),是世界上最畅销的SOA图书的作者,也是PrenticeHall出版的“ThomasErl面向服务计算系列”丛书的系列编辑,同时还是SOA杂志(http://www.soamag.com)的编辑。他的书在全世界印刷了超过十万册,并且得到了很多大型软件组织资深成员的认可,其中包括IBM、Microsoft、Oracle、BEA、Sun、Intel、SAP和HP。  在他出版了该丛书的前3本,也就是Service-OrientedArchitecture:AFieldGuidetoIntegratingXMLandWebServices、Service-OrientedArchitecture:Concepts,Technology,andDesign(中译版《SOA概念技术与设计》)和SOA:PrinciplesofServiceDesign(中译版《SOA服务设计原则》)(http://www.soaprinciples.tom)之后,又与多位业界知名专家合著了最新的两本书:SOADesignPatterns(http:llwww.soapatterns.com)与本书。  ThomasErl同时也是SOASystemsInc.(http://www.soasystems.com)的创始人,这是一个专门进行SOA培训、提供厂商无关的策略咨询服务的公司。Thomas还是国际知名的SOA认证专业人员项目的创建人(http://www.soacp.com和http://www.soasch001.com)。Thomas是一个经常参与私人和公众活动的演说家和讲师,并且主办了很多讨论会和主题演讲。Thomas所著的论文和接受的采访发表在很多期刊上,其中包括《华尔街期刊》。

书籍规格:

书籍详细信息
书名SOA Web Service合约设计与版本化站内查询相似图书
9787115218193
如需购买下载《SOA Web Service合约设计与版本化》pdf扫描版电子书或查询更多相关信息,请直接复制isbn,搜索即可全网搜索该ISBN
出版地北京出版单位人民邮电出版社
版次1版印次1
定价(元)79.0语种简体中文
尺寸24 × 19装帧平装
页数 320 印数 3000

书籍信息归属:

SOA Web Service合约设计与版本化是人民邮电出版社于2009.12出版的中图分类号为 TP368.5 的主题关于 互联网络-网络服务器 的书籍。